delete_workspace¶
- IoTSiteWise.Client.delete_workspace(**kwargs)¶
Deletes a workspace. Before you delete a workspace, you must delete all resources contained in or associated with the workspace, such as datasets, time series, pipelines, and tasks.

Request Syntax
response = client.delete_workspace( workspaceName='string', clientToken='string' )
- Parameters:
workspaceName (string) –
[REQUIRED]
The name of the workspace to delete.
clientToken (string) –
A unique, case-sensitive identifier that you provide to ensure that the request is idempotent. If you retry a request that completed successfully using the same client token, the retry succeeds without performing any further actions.
This field is autopopulated if not provided.
- Return type:
dict
- Returns:
Response Syntax
{ 'workspaceStatus': { 'state': 'CREATING'|'ACTIVE'|'UPDATING'|'DELETING'|'FAILED', 'error': { 'code': 'VALIDATION_ERROR'|'INTERNAL_FAILURE', 'message': 'string' } } }
Response Structure
(dict) –
workspaceStatus (dict) –
The status of the workspace after the deletion request, which is
DELETINGwhen the operation returns.state (string) –
The current state of the workspace.
error (dict) –
Contains associated error information, if any.
code (string) –
The error code.
message (string) –
The error message.
